It's important to understand what termites are and how they operate.   Termites are commonly known as white ants or anai-anai in local Malay language. They are small in size (4-11 mm) and have three body parts namely, the head, thorax and abdomen. They are social insects that live in colonies.

Each caste has its own function within a colony which characterized by the allotment of labor within the castes together with the sharing of meals, shelter and sources and cooperation in rearing the young. Termite colonies contain nymphs, workers, soldiers, and reproductive individuals of both genders, occasionally containing several egg-laying queens.

What theyre really following is cellulose.  One of the most abundant organic compounds on Earth that can be found in timber or plant cells.And any tiniest of openings left behind leading in to your residence, are treated as a suitable invitation by termites. Lack of ventilation and increased moisture can also help endure and invite in to a home.What are Signs of InfestationA new termite infestation starts in a swarm.

When a termite colony is fully-developed, it begins producing swarmers termites with wings. These swarmers fly out from their colonies, find a partner, and when their wings are lost they partner. These swarming seasons can occur in different times for different termites.For subterraneans, this season begins when it begins to get warmer, usually after a rain event.
